ORGANIZATION AND BASIS OF PRESENTATION
The preparation of the accompanying unaudited consolidated financial statements in conformity with accounting principles generally accepted in the United States of America (“U.S. GAAP”) requires management to make estimates and assumptions (including normal, recurring accruals) that affect the reported amounts of assets and liabilities and the disclosure of contingent assets and liabilities at the date of the consolidated financial statements and the reported amounts of revenues and expenses during the reporting periods. Actual results could differ from these estimates. The accompanying unaudited interim consolidated financial statements reflect all adjustments necessary in the opinion of management for a fair statement of the consolidated financial position of AXA Equitable and its consolidated results of operations and cash flows for the periods presented. All significant intercompany transactions and balances have been eliminated in consolidation. These statements should be read in conjunction with the audited Consolidated Financial Statements of AXA Equitable for the year ended December 31, 2016. The results of operations for the three months ended March 31, 2017 are not necessarily indicative of the results to be expected for the full year.
The accompanying consolidated financial statements include the accounts of AXA Equitable and its subsidiaries engaged in insurance related businesses (collectively, the “Insurance segment”); other subsidiaries, principally AB, engaged in investment management related businesses (the “Investment Management segment”), partnerships and joint ventures in which AXA Equitable or its subsidiaries have control and a majority economic interest as well as those variable interest entities (“VIEs”) that meet the requirements for consolidation (collectively the “Company”).
At March 31, 2017 and December 31, 2016, AXA Equitable’s economic interest in AB was 29.0% and 29.0%. At March 31, 2017 and December 31, 2016, respectively, AXA and its subsidiaries’ economic interest in AB was 63.8% and 63.7%.
The terms “first quarter 2017” and “first quarter 2016” refer to the three months ended March 31, 2017 and 2016, respectively. The terms “first three months of 2017” and “first three months of 2016” refer to the three months ended March 31, 2017 and 2016, respectively.
Certain reclassifications have been made in the amounts presented for prior periods to conform those periods to the current presentation.
